コード例 #1
0
        private void btnConsultarIda_Click_1(object sender, EventArgs e)
        {
            try
            {
                if (valCiudadOrigenIda.Text == "")
                {
                    throw new System.Exception("Seleccione una ciudad origen");
                }

                if (valCiudadDestinoIda.Text == "")
                {
                    throw new System.Exception("Seleccione una ciudad destino");
                }

                if (valFechaIda.Text == "")
                {
                    throw new System.Exception("Seleccione la fecha");
                }

                string fecha = valFechaIda.Value.ToString("yyyy-MM-dd");

                ItinerarioVuelos itinerarioVuelos = new ItinerarioVuelos();

                int idCiudadOrigen  = Convert.ToInt32(valCiudadOrigenIda.SelectedValue);
                int idCiudadDestino = Convert.ToInt32(valCiudadDestinoIda.SelectedValue);
                ItinerarioDeVuelos[] itinerarioDeVuelos = itinerarioVuelos.consultarItinerarioIda(idCiudadOrigen, idCiudadDestino, fecha);

                dataGridVuelosIda.DataSource = itinerarioDeVuelos;
            }
            catch (Exception ex)
            {
                MessageBox.Show(null, ex.Message, "", MessageBoxButtons.OKCancel, MessageBoxIcon.Error);
            }
        }
コード例 #2
0
        public consultaReserva(int idusuario)
        {
            InitializeComponent();

            ItinerarioVuelos itinerarioVuelos = new ItinerarioVuelos();

            Reservas[] reserva = itinerarioVuelos.consultarReservas(idusuario);
            dataGridReservas.DataSource = reserva;
        }
コード例 #3
0
        private void button1_Click(object sender, EventArgs e)
        {
            if (valCantidadPer.Text != "")
            {
                ItinerarioVuelos itinerarioVuelos = new ItinerarioVuelos();
                int cantidadPer  = Convert.ToInt32(valCantidadPer.Text);
                int costoReserva = Convert.ToInt32(valCostoReserva.Text);

                itinerarioVuelos.InsertarReserva(
                    stIditinerario, stUsuaio.IdUsuario, 1, cantidadPer, costoReserva);
            }
        }
コード例 #4
0
        public VuelosIda()
        {
            InitializeComponent();

            ItinerarioVuelos itinerarioVuelos = new ItinerarioVuelos();

            Ciudad[] ciudadOrigen = itinerarioVuelos.consultarCiudad();
            valCiudadOrigenIda.DisplayMember = "nomciudad";
            valCiudadOrigenIda.ValueMember   = "idciudad";
            valCiudadOrigenIda.DataSource    = ciudadOrigen;

            Ciudad[] ciudadDestino = itinerarioVuelos.consultarCiudad();
            valCiudadDestinoIda.DisplayMember = "nomciudad";
            valCiudadDestinoIda.ValueMember   = "idciudad";
            valCiudadDestinoIda.DataSource    = ciudadDestino;
        }
コード例 #5
0
        private void seleccionarVuelo_Click(object sender, EventArgs e)
        {
            int    iditinerario = (int)dataGridVuelosIda.CurrentRow.Cells["Iditinerario"].Value;
            string fechaVuelta  = valFechaIdaVuelta2.Value.ToString("yyyy-MM-dd");

            int idCiudadOrigen  = Convert.ToInt32(valCiudadOrigenIdaVuelta.SelectedValue);
            int idCiudadDestino = Convert.ToInt32(valCiudadDestinoIdaVuelta.SelectedValue);

            ItinerarioVuelos itinerarioVuelos = new ItinerarioVuelos();

            ItinerarioDeVuelos[] itinerarioDeVuelos = itinerarioVuelos.consultarItinerarioVuelta(idCiudadOrigen, idCiudadDestino, fechaVuelta, iditinerario);

            dataGridVuelosVuelta.DataSource = itinerarioDeVuelos;

            panelVuelosIda.Enabled    = false;
            panelVuelosVuelta.Visible = true;
        }